11 Senator Kirkpatrick moved the following amendment:
12
13 Senate Amendment (with title amendment)
14 On page 3, between lines 8 and 9,
15
16 insert:
17 Section 3. Paragraph (f) of subsection (9) of section
18 259.101, Florida Statutes, is amended to read:
19 259.101 Florida Preservation 2000 Act.--
20 (9)
21 (f)1. Pursuant to subsection (3) and beginning in
22 fiscal year 1999-2000 1998-1999, that portion of the
23 unencumbered balances of each program described in paragraphs
24 (3)(c), (d), (e), (f), and (g) which has been on deposit in
25 such program's Preservation 2000 account for more than two
26 fiscal years shall be redistributed equally to the Department
27 of Environmental Protection, Division of State Lands P200
28 subaccount for the purchase of state lands as described in s.
29 250.032 and Water Management District P2000 subaccount for the
30 purchase of water management lands pursuant to ss. 373.59,
31 373.456, and 373.4592 Conservation and Recreation Lands Trust

1 Fund and the Water Management Lands Trust Fund. For the
2 purposes of this subsection, the term "unencumbered balances"
3 means the portion of Preservation 2000 bond proceeds which is
4 not obligated through the signing of a purchase contract
5 between a public agency and a private landowner, except that
6 the program described in paragraph (3)(c) may not lose any
7 portion of its unencumbered funds which remain unobligated
8 because of extraordinary circumstances that hampered the
9 affected local governments' abilities to close on land
10 acquisition projects approved through the Florida Communities
11 Trust program. Extraordinary circumstances shall be
12 determined by the Florida Communities Trust governing body and
13 may include such things as death or bankruptcy of the owner of
14 property; a change in the land use designation of the
15 property; natural disasters that affected a local government's
16 ability to consummate the sales contract on such property; or
17 any other condition that the Florida Communities Trust
18 governing board determined to be extraordinary. The portion of
19 the funds deposited in the Water Management Lands Trust Fund
20 shall be distributed to the water management districts as
21 provided in s. 373.59(7).
22 2. The department and the water management districts
23 may enter into joint acquisition agreements to jointly fund
24 the purchase of lands using alternatives to fee simple
25 techniques.
